"No, please no!" She sobbed, clutching his body in her lace clad arms.

"You promised me a forever! You're not suppose to leave me! NOT AFTER THIS!" The ruby red liquid soaked through the expensive suit, onto her large white dress. The veil sticking to her neck. This was suppose to be a happy day, not one of death.

Soon, the white was replaced with black, and the blood was replaced with sorrow. The hopeful girl, at 21, was now filled with resentment to humanity. A man she had loved since she was merely a high schooler, was now laying in a casket. She will never see hiss beautiful brown eyes, the color of fresh coffee. Never will she see the quirky smile of his when she scrunched up her nose.

She will never feel his fingers traveling over her body, connecting the freckles as if they were stars and her body was the universe.

She will never be able to have a family with him, cause he's gone, he's dead, there's no going back.

So, she'll sit and wait, she'll wait till she's united with him agaain.
